CSU-Pueblo Athletics Total Nine Academic All-Americans in 2018-19
A total of nine CSU-Pueblo student-athletes earned CoSIDA Academic All-America honors in 2018-19. The cross country/track and field teams highlighted the group with five, including Derrick Williams, who was named the Male XC/T&F Academic Athlete of the Year. The nine student-athletes were: Nicole Bouma (Women's XC/Track & Field), Michaela Burpee (Softball), Courtney Ewing (Women's Golf), Lauren Fairchild (Women's XC/Track & Field), Shawn Horne (Men's XC/Track & Field), Marcelo Laguera (Men's XC/Track & Field), Austin Micci (Football), Kevin Ribarich (Football) and Derrick Williams (Men's XC/Track & Field).
CSU-Pueblo allocated $1.9 Million for upgrades to ThunderBowl and Massari Arena
The Colorado State University-Pueblo Athletic Department has received $1.9 million for facility improvements to the Neta and Eddie DeRose ThunderBowl and Massari Arena. The commitment to Pack Athletics comes as part of CSU-Pueblo's Vision 2028, a 10-year strategic plan to establish CSU-Pueblo as the "people's university of the Southwest." In August, Vision 2028 was supported unanimously by the Colorado State University System Board of Governors with a total investment of $7.8 million to CSU-Pueblo for initiatives outlined in the 10-year strategic plan.
CSU-Pueblo Athletics awarded $1 million from the Rawlings Foundation
Colorado State University-Pueblo Athletics has secured $1 million from the Robert Hoag Rawlings Foundation to help renovate the Rawlings Baseball and Softball Complex. This donation was the lead gift as part of a $4.5 million capital improvement plan. The Rawlings Sports Complex encompasses both baseball and softball venues on the campus of Colorado State University-Pueblo. Since securing the gift from the Rawlings Foundation, CSU-Pueblo Athletics has reached $3.1 of the $4.5 million needs for renovations.
CSU-Pueblo Athletics announces Hall of Fame Class of 2019
The 2019 class of the Colorado State University-Pueblo Athletics Hall of Fame features six former student-athletes, a coach and special contributor who dedicated more than two decades to the University and a men's basketball team with the most wins in program history. The group assembled Oct. 19 at the 10th Annual CSU-Pueblo Athletics Hall of Fame Banquet and at halftime of the CSU-Pueblo Football Homecoming game.
